Clarinda Herald Journal, June 3, 1942:
INJURIES FATAL TO PEARL MILLES0N Funeral Services Held This Monday. Afternoon Injuries suffered when he fell at the Swift & Co plant last Tuesday afternoon proved fatal to Pearl C Mllleson. GC, whose death occurred at the Municipal Hospital Thursday evening. Funeral services were held at the Walker Funeral home this Monday afternoon. Burial was made in Clarinda cemetery. Milleson. engineer at Swift's for over 20 years, suffered a fractured skull and other lnjuries when he fell at the plant. He* Is survived by his wife, three sons. Pearl,.,jr of Los Angeles, Calif. Lloyd and Merrill of Clarinda also two daughters', Mrs Victor Pence of Camas, Washington, and Mrs Irvln Castle of Clarinda.
